Index of /_SITEIMAGE/view/aW1hZ2UubXNzY2RuLm5ldA/66/94/a2/c8
Name
Last modified
Size
Description
Parent Directory
-
6694a2c800746b7b9efd..>
2024-11-08 03:22
21K
6694a2c800746b7b9efd..>
2024-11-03 17:52
21K